Note

● When changing settings for camera’s installation conditions, you need to recapture

a panorama image and register again.

● Panorama Preview may be slightly different from the actual picture. You need to

check if the view restrictions are correctly reflected in VB Viewer after the view

restrictions have been set.

● You should use VB Viewer when confirming the setting. (view restriction is not

applied in Admin Viewer.)

● If changing the setting of Image Stabilizer after View Restriction settings, the view

restriction area may be different between when it is set and when it is actually used

(

→ P.3-20).

● When changing Image Stabilizer or Digital Zoom setting, you need to reconfirm

the view restriction.

Tip

● Even when view restriction is set, if the camera is controlled to capture near the

boundary of the view restrictions, the restricted area may be momentarily captured.

● To release view restriction, clear the “Apply the view restriction” check box and

then click “Apply” and “Save View Restriction”.

● When the value is blank while “Apply the view restriction” is checked, the maximum

view restriction value is used.
